Rent vs buy

Price-to-rent ratio: 12.4
Buy

At a 12.4 price-to-rent ratio, buying generally beats renting in North Little Rock on a long-enough horizon. The headline math is that one year of mortgage payments approximates 12.4 years of rent — well below the 15+ threshold where ownership starts to dominate.

About North Little Rock

North Little Rock is a city in Pulaski County, Arkansas, with an estimated population of 64,498. It anchors the Little Rock-North Little Rock-Conway metro area. The median home value in North Little Rock is $164,494 as of 2026-04, up 2.1% over the last 12 months. Over the last five years, home values have averaged +3.8% annual growth, with prices at or near the 5-year peak. Rents in North Little Rock average $1,107 per month, roughly flat year-over-year (+0.6%). The composite momentum score is 60 of 100 (Stable). Conditions are neither hot nor cold, so the local fit matters more than market timing.

About North Little Rock (Wikipedia)

North Little Rock is a city in Pulaski County, Arkansas, United States. Located on the north side of the Arkansas River, it is the twin city of Little Rock. In the late nineteenth century, it was annexed by Little Rock for a period, but regained its independence in the early 20th century. The population was 64,591 at the 2020 census, making it the seventh-most populous city in Arkansas.
